A Kentucky State University English professor received a book contract for her upcoming scholarly work about a historic writer.

Dr. April D. Fallon, professor of English, received a contract to publish “Maeve Brennan: A Migrant Mind.”

“The book is about Maeve Brennan, fiction writer and essayist for the New Yorker,” Fallon said. “She was the first full time woman writer on the staff of the New Yorker. The book examines Brennan’s writing through the lens of her viewpoint as a keen eyed migrant in both Ireland and the US.”

Fallon has worked at Kentucky State for 22 years. Her main research interests are women’s literature, Modernism, Irish literature and poetry.

“This is my first scholarly book,” Fallon said. “I have published two books of poetry: ‘Mindseye’s Consort’ in 2013 and ‘Universe of Discourse’ in 2011.”
